What Is An Obgyn?

In the context of healthcare in the Central African Republic (CAR), an OBGYN, or Obstetrician-Gynecologist, is a medical specialist dedicated to the comprehensive health of women throughout their reproductive lives. This field encompasses two critical disciplines: Obstetrics, which focuses on pregnancy, childbirth, and the postpartum period, and Gynecology, which addresses the health of the female reproductive system from adolescence through menopause and beyond.

OBGYNs play a vital role in the CAR's healthcare infrastructure by providing essential preventive, diagnostic, and therapeutic services. Their expertise is crucial for managing the unique health challenges faced by women in the region, including high maternal and infant mortality rates, limited access to specialized care, and the prevalence of specific gynecological conditions. They are frontline providers for ensuring safe pregnancies and births, addressing reproductive tract infections, and managing a spectrum of gynecological disorders.

  • Prenatal care, including risk assessment, monitoring fetal development, and managing pregnancy-related complications.
  • Management of labor and delivery, including normal vaginal births and operative interventions when necessary.
  • Postpartum care, focusing on recovery, breastfeeding support, and addressing potential complications.
  • Diagnosis and treatment of a wide range of gynecological conditions such as menstrual irregularities, pelvic pain, endometriosis, fibroids, and ovarian cysts.
  • Screening and management of sexually transmitted infections (STIs) and cervical cancer (e.g., through Pap smears and colposcopy).
  • Family planning services, including contraception counseling and provision.
  • Menopause management and addressing age-related gynecological health concerns.

Who Needs Obgyn In Central African Republic?

Comprehensive obstetric and gynecological care is a critical need across a spectrum of healthcare facilities in the Central African Republic. From large-scale tertiary care centers to community-level primary care clinics, the demand for specialized OBGYN services remains consistently high.

  • Teaching Hospitals & University Medical Centers: These institutions serve as hubs for advanced obstetric and gynecological procedures, complex case management, and the training of future medical professionals. They require robust OBGYN departments to handle high-risk pregnancies, intricate surgeries, and specialized diagnostics.
  • Regional & District Hospitals: These facilities play a vital role in providing essential obstetric and gynecological services to wider populations. They are often the first point of referral for complicated cases and require well-equipped OBGYN departments capable of handling common deliveries, C-sections, and basic gynecological interventions.
  • Maternity Hospitals & Specialized Clinics: Dedicated maternity hospitals and specialized women's health clinics are paramount for routine prenatal care, normal deliveries, postpartum support, and the management of common gynecological conditions. They focus on providing accessible and focused care for women's reproductive health.
  • Community Health Centers & Rural Clinics: Even at the community level, basic obstetric and gynecological services are essential. These facilities often provide essential antenatal and postnatal care, family planning services, and the identification and referral of high-risk pregnancies or gynecological emergencies to higher-level facilities. Ensuring access to trained personnel and essential supplies in these settings is crucial for reducing maternal and infant mortality.

How Much Is An Obgyn In The Central African Republic?

Understanding the cost of obstetric and gynecological (OBGYN) care in the Central African Republic (CAR) is essential for individuals and organizations planning healthcare services or seeking personal medical attention. While exact figures can fluctuate based on numerous factors, including geographic location within the CAR (e.g., major cities versus rural areas), the specific facility (public vs. private, hospital vs. clinic), and the complexity of the medical service required, a general price range can be estimated. It's important to note that these costs are typically presented in the local currency, the Central African CFA franc (XAF).

For routine consultations and check-ups with an OBGYN, you might expect to see fees ranging broadly from approximately 15,000 XAF to 40,000 XAF. This range covers standard appointments for prenatal care, general gynecological examinations, and initial consultations for common concerns. More specialized services, such as ultrasounds (sonograms), diagnostic tests, or minor surgical procedures, will naturally incur higher costs. For instance, a more involved diagnostic procedure or a specialized scan could fall within the range of 40,000 XAF to 100,000 XAF or even more, depending on the specific tests performed and the expertise of the practitioner.

It's crucial to recognize that access to OBGYN services, particularly in more remote regions, can be limited, and costs can be affected by the availability of qualified professionals and advanced medical equipment. For surgical interventions, such as C-sections or other gynecological surgeries, prices can vary significantly, potentially ranging from 150,000 XAF to several hundred thousand XAF, factoring in pre-operative assessments, the surgery itself, post-operative care, and any necessary medications or hospital stays. For the most accurate and up-to-date pricing, direct inquiry with healthcare providers in the CAR is highly recommended.

  • Routine OBGYN consultations: 15,000 - 40,000 XAF
  • Specialized diagnostics and ultrasounds: 40,000 - 100,000+ XAF
  • Surgical procedures (e.g., C-sections): 150,000 - several hundred thousand XAF
